Decorate a home, stock a pantry or find a unique gift at this extravaganza of international goodies..
In Short
Shoppers find unique, budget-friendly items, including stylish home accents: baskets from Bali, pottery from Portugal and an eclectic mix of furniture (kitchen islands, tables,
couches, bar stools, cabinets). A wide selection of linens, kitchen utensils, dishware, candles, garden decor and bath items are also available. Foodies love to linger in the many aisles filled with gourmet treats like marinated vegetables, olives, spices, grilling oils, cooking sauces, Belgian chocolate, coffee and hundreds of fine wines.…
